2019 Honda Borough review: Our expert's take

What Is the 2019 Honda Borough?

The Honda Civic is a front-drive compact machine available in sedan, coupe and four-door hatchback body styles. It competes with the Hyundai Elantra, Nissan Sentra and Toyota Corolla. The sedan and coupe tin be powered by a standard 158-horsepower, two.0-liter four-cylinder engine or a 174-hp, turbocharged 1.v-liter four-cylinder, while the regular hatchback comes only with the 1.5-liter engine.

For performance-minded drivers, Honda sells Si and Blazon R versions of the Civic. The Si model is available in sedan and coupe form and features a 205-hp version of the turbo 1.5-liter engine. The ultra-performance Type R comes merely every bit a hatchback with four seats and is powered by a 306-hp, turbocharged ii.0-liter four-cylinder. A six-speed manual is the only manual offered for the Si and Type R.

What's New on the 2019 Honda Civic?

Subtle front and rear styling changes update the looks of the sedan and coupe. Inside, in that location's ameliorate audio insulation, updated trim and the add-on of a volume knob and difficult keys for the bachelor Display Audio touchscreen multimedia organisation. A new Sport trim level slots between the base LX and midlevel EX, and the Honda Sensing suite of active rubber features is now standard. Honda Sensing includes adaptive cruise control, forward standoff warning with automatic emergency braking, lane departure alert, lane-keeping assistance and automatic high-beam headlights. (Si and Type R models don't get Honda Sensing).

What Features in the 2019 Honda Civic Are Most Important?

The Honda Sensing suite adds a lot of worthwhile active prophylactic features to the Borough'southward standard features list. Stepping up to the Sport trim brings the Display Sound touchscreen multimedia system with Apple CarPlay and Android Machine smartphone connectivity. Moving to the EX trim brings Honda's useful LaneWatch system, which uses a camera in the passenger-side mirror to help you keep an heart on things on the right side of the car, like cyclists in a bike lane.

Should I Buy the 2019 Honda Civic?

Even lower trim levels of the Civic deliver an engaging driving feel, and the high-output Type R ratchets the driving fun upward considerably. It'southward worth looking at the turbo 1.v-liter engine over the base 2.0-liter considering it offers better performance and gas mileage.
